Cost of living in Prescott Valley, Arizona

Cost of living in Prescott Valley research summary. The cost of living index is set to 100 for the average place in the United States. A cost of living index above 100 means Prescott Valley is expensive. An index value below 100 means the city is a relatively cheap place to live.

On a city-by-city basis in Arizona, home prices and rent have the biggest impact on the cost of living. Here are the key takeaways based on Saturday Night Science:

111 Cost of living index 1.1x higher vs US
#52 Cheapest in Arizona (of 91)
#3,622 Cheapest in the U.S. (of 6,489)
$462,396 Median home value
$1,580 Median rent
$74,569 Median income

What is the cost of living in Prescott Valley, AZ?

According to the most recent data on the cost of living, Prescott Valley has an overall cost of living index of 111, which is 1.1x higher than the national index of 100.

Compared to Arizona, Prescott Valley has a cost of living index that's 1.1x higher than Arizona's index of 100.

The standard of living in Prescott Valley ranks as #52 most affordable out of the 91 places we measured in Arizona. By definition, that implies Prescott Valley ranks as the #39 most expensive place in the Grand Canyon State.

Prescott Valley Cost Of Living Vs. Arizona

Six factors go into calculating the cost of living index in Prescott Valley. Here is how it fares on each of the criteria:

  • The Services index in Prescott Valley is 102.

  • The Groceries index in Prescott Valley is 103.

  • The Health index in Prescott Valley is 133.

  • The Housing index in Prescott Valley is 102.

  • The Transportation index in Prescott Valley is 112.

  • The Utilities index in Prescott Valley is 103.

Living Expense Prescott Valley Arizona National Average
Overall 111 100 100
Services 102 99 100
Groceries 103 99 100
Health 133 97 100
Housing 102 104 100
Transportation 112 113 100
Utilities 103 104 100

Prescott Valley, AZ Housing Cost Breakdown

$462,396Median Home Value
$1,580Median Rent
$74,569Median Income

Housing swings affordability the most between places in Arizona, so we broke down housing costs into more detail. Home and income data comes from the most recent US Census ACS 2020-2024. The key points are:

  • The Median Home Value in Prescott Valley is $462,396.

  • The Median Rent in Prescott Valley is $1,580.

  • The Median Income in Prescott Valley is $74,569.

  • The Home Value To Income in Prescott Valley is 6.2x.

  • The Rent To Monthly Income in Prescott Valley is 0.25x.

Statistic Prescott Valley Arizona United States
Median Home Value $462,396 $423,329 $332,700
Median Rent $1,580 $1,543 $1,413
Median Income $74,569 $79,964 $80,734
Home Value To Income 6.2x 5.3x 4.1x
Rent To Monthly Income 0.25x 0.23x 0.21x
